It translates binary instruction codes from controllers into specific control signals that activate machine functions like motor movements, valve operations, or sensor readings.
While microprocessors execute sequential instructions, decoding logic arrays perform parallel pattern matching and signal generation with minimal latency, making them ideal for real-time control applications.
Yes, when implemented using programmable logic devices (PLDs or FPGAs), they can be reconfigured. Fixed ASIC implementations require hardware changes for different decoding patterns.
